Feature request
Let's discuss how to expand the list of teams and their folders - https://github.com/nextcloud/circles/issues/2781
We should provide some more transparency there, with a few possible changes:
- add search and sorting on top
- Add more information. In particular:
- visibility setting
- sharing settings: federated sharing allowed, the not-yet-existing "allow sharing of team owned resources", password protection, ...
- invitation settings (esp if moderated or free-join)
- members - have a button to see all members.
- resources - have a button to see all resources owned by the team
- are resources of the team shared outside the team (yes, no, if yes - show which)
- are resources of the team shared outside the organization (public links) (yes, no, if yes - show which)
- group the team is in (once we assign those)
- who initially created the team?
Not saying we should do all ;-)
